Physical and Chemical Properties

Appearance
Colorless crystalline solid or brown chunky solid.
Solubility in water
Insoluble
Melting Point
75
Boiling Point
217
Vapor Pressure
0.093 (25 C)
Density
0.965 g/cm3 (20 C)
pKa/pKb
10.42 (pKa)
Partition Coefficient
2.4
Heat Of Vaporization
47.2 kJ/mol
Usage
Solvent, chemical intermediate (eg, for sulfur dyes), isomeric mixt is chemical intermediate for gasoline, lubricating oil and elastomer antioxidants.
Vapor Density
4.23
Odor threshold
0.5 mg/L (detection in water)
Refractive Index
1.5172 (74 C)

First Aid Measures

Ingestion
Do NOT induce vomiting. If victim is conscious and alert, give 2-4 cupfuls of milk or water. Never give anything by mouth to an unconscious person. Get medical aid immediately.
Inhalation
Get medical aid immediately. Remove from exposure to fresh air immediately. If breathing is difficult, give oxygen. DO NOT use mouth-to-mouth respiration. If breathing has ceased apply artificial respiration using oxygen and a suitable mechanical device such as a bag and a mask.
Skin
Get medical aid immediately. Immediately flush skin with plenty of soap and water for at least 15 minutes while removing contaminated clothing and shoes. Wash clothing before reuse. Destroy contaminated shoes.
Eyes
Get medical aid immediately. Do NOT allow victim to rub or keep eyes closed. Extensive irrigation is required (at least 30 minutes).

Handling and Storage

Storage
Keep container closed when not in use. Store in a tightly closed container. Store in a cool, dry, well-ventilated area away from incompatible substances. Do not store in steel container.
Handling
Wash thoroughly after handling. Remove contaminated clothing and wash before reuse. Use only in a well ventilated area. Minimize dust generation and accumulation. Do not get in eyes, on skin, or on clothing. Keep container tightly closed. Do not ingest or inhale. Discard contaminated shoes.

Hazards Identification

Inhalation
Causes chemical burns to the respiratory tract. Aspiration may lead to pulmonary edema. May cause systemic effects.
Skin
Harmful if absorbed through the skin. Causes skin burns. May cause skin rash (in milder cases), and cold and clammy skin with cyanosis or pale color.
Eyes
Causes eye burns. May cause chemical conjunctivitis and corneal damage.
Ingestion
Harmful if swallowed. May cause severe and permanent damage to the digestive tract. Causes gastrointestinal tract burns. May cause perforation of the digestive tract. May cause systemic effects.
Hazards
When heated, vapors may form explosive mixtures with air: indoors, outdoors, and sewers explosion hazards.

Accidental Release Measures

Small spills/leaks
Vacuum or sweep up material and place into a suitable disposal container. Clean up spills immediately, using the appropriate protective equipment. Avoid generating dusty conditions. Provide ventilation.

Stability and Reactivity

Incompatibilities
Bases, acid anhydrides, acid chlorides, oxidizing agents, steel, brass, copper, copper alloys.
Stability
Stable under normal temperatures and pressures.
Decomposition
Carbon monoxide, irritating and toxic fumes and gases, carbon dioxide.
Combustion Products
Fire may produce irritating, corrosive and/or toxic gases.
